The Hidden Danger: Blind Spots and Truck Accidents

For truck drivers like Maria, the road is a second home—but it's also a place where split-second decisions mean the difference between arriving safely and disaster. According to the Federal Motor Carrier Safety Administration (FMCSA), over 40% of truck-related accidents involve collisions with passenger vehicles, cyclists, or pedestrians in the truck's blind spots. These "no-zones" – the areas around the truck where visibility is limited or nonexistent – are a constant source of stress for drivers and a leading cause of preventable tragedies.

Traditional truck rear view mirrors help, but they're limited. They can't see around corners, in heavy rain, or at night. And even the most experienced drivers can miss a pedestrian stepping into a blind spot or a car merging too closely. This is where technology steps in: enter the AI BSD (Blind Spot Detection) system—a game-changer for truck safety that's transforming how drivers, fleet managers, and manufacturers approach road security.

What is an AI BSD System?

An AI BSD system isn't just another gadget—it's a proactive safety net. Combining advanced cameras, proximity sensors, and artificial intelligence, these systems act as an extra set of eyes (and a voice) for drivers, detecting vehicles, pedestrians, and obstacles in blind spots before a collision can occur. Unlike basic rear view cameras, AI BSD systems don't just show what's behind or beside the truck; they analyze the environment, recognize threats, and alert drivers in real time.

How AI BSD Systems Work: Beyond the Camera

Let's break down the magic behind these systems. Imagine Maria's truck: mounted on the side mirrors are high-definition cameras with 170-degree wide-angle lenses, paired with proximity sensors that scan the area around the truck 20 times per second. These cameras feed live video to a monitor in the cab—often a 10.1" touch screen with quad-view capabilities—while the sensors send data to an AI-powered processor. This processor uses machine learning algorithms to distinguish between a parked car, a cyclist, and a stray animal, prioritizing threats based on speed and distance.

When the system detects a vehicle merging into the blind spot or a pedestrian stepping into the truck's path, it triggers two alerts: a visual warning (a flashing icon on the monitor) and an audio alert ("Right blind spot: vehicle approaching"). 2. IP68 Waterproof Rating: Tough Enough for Any Weather

Rain, snow, mud, or? No problem. Our truck cameras and sensors are rated IP68, meaning they're dust-tight and can withstand submersion in up to 1.5 meters of water for 30 minutes.
